What is the Producer Price Index (PPI)?

The Producer Price Index (PPI) tracks the changes in the selling prices of goods at the producer level. It includes prices for goods at various stages of production, from raw materials to finished goods. PPI is calculated by comparing the current period's prices to a base period, typically a year earlier.

There are two main types of PPI:

  • Producer Price Index by Industry (PPI-I): Measures price changes for goods by industry.
  • Producer Price Index by Commodity (PPI-C): Measures price changes for specific commodities.

PPI is distinct from the Consumer Price Index (CPI), which measures price changes from the consumer perspective. While CPI reflects what consumers pay at the retail level, PPI reflects what producers receive for their goods.

How PPI Uses Current Output to Calculate Real GDP

Real GDP is a measure of economic output adjusted for inflation. It provides a more accurate picture of economic growth by accounting for changes in the price level. The formula for Real GDP is:

Real GDP = (Nominal GDP / PPI) × 100

Where:

  • Nominal GDP is the total market value of all final goods and services produced in a country in a given period.
  • PPI is the Producer Price Index, which accounts for price changes in the production process.

By dividing Nominal GDP by the PPI and multiplying by 100, we obtain Real GDP, which reflects the actual economic output in terms of the base year's prices.

This adjustment is crucial because it allows economists to compare economic performance across different time periods, controlling for inflationary effects. For example, if Nominal GDP grows by 5% but PPI rises by 3%, Real GDP growth would be 2%, indicating actual economic expansion.

Worked Example

Let's consider an example to illustrate how PPI is used to calculate Real GDP.

Scenario: In 2023, the Nominal GDP is $2,000 billion, and the PPI is 120. The base year is 2022.

Using the formula:

Real GDP = ($2,000 billion / 120) × 100 = $1,666.67 billion

This means that the actual economic output in 2023, adjusted for inflation, is $1,666.67 billion, compared to the base year's prices.

This example shows how Real GDP provides a more accurate measure of economic activity by accounting for inflationary effects.
